Datura Stramonium Lectin-AF594 (DSL-AF594) is a datura lectin (DSL) labeled with the AF594 fluorescent dye. Datura Stramonium Lectin is a dimeric glycoprotein that specifically recognizes and binds to glycan structures containing N-acetylglucosamine (GlcNAc) oligomers. Datura Stramonium Lectin-AF594 can be used for glycosyl studies on cell surfaces (Ex/Em = 590/617 nm).

2',5'-Dideoxy-3'-ATP is an adenylate cyclase inhibitor. 2',5'-Dideoxy-3'-ATP exerts linear noncompetitive inhibition via binding to the distinct P-site. 2',5'-Dideoxy-3'-ATP binds and stabilizes the dimeric form of Mycobacterium avium adenylyl cyclase Ma1120 to inhibit activity .

3P-RGD2 is a dimeric cyclic RGD (Arg-Gly-Asp) peptide. When radiolabeled with 99mTc, 3P-RGD2 serves as a selective radiotracer for integrin αvβ3. When radiolabeled with 99mTc, 3P-RGD2 enables single-photon emission computed tomography imaging of integrin αvβ3 .

Anabsinthin is a dimeric sesquiterpene lactone. Anabsinthin can be found in Artemisia absinthium L. (wormwood). Anabsinthin modulates intracellular calcium levels, mediates anti-inflammatory and antioxidant effects. Anabsinthin inhibits Phorbol 12-myristate 13-acetate (HY-18739)-induced superoxide anion production, increased iNOS and MUC5AC protein expression, and IL-1β transcription upregulation. Anabsinthin can be used for the research of citrus canker .

SYN1327 is a potent monomeric cyclic competitive antagonistic peptide targeting the neonatal Fc receptor (FcRn), with a Kd of 31 nM for human FcRn at pH 6 and a Kd of 170 nM at pH 7.4. SYN1327 competitively binds to the IgG-binding site of FcRn and inhibits the binding of human IgG to FcRn. SYN1327 acts as the monomeric precursor of the dimeric peptide SYN1436 (HY-P11882). SYN1327 can be used in studies related to IgG-mediated autoimmune diseases .

Telomeric G4s ligand 2 is an orally active, selective ligand of telomeric G-quadruplex (G4), with an IC50 of 0.4 μM. Telomeric G4s ligand 2 binds to dimeric telomeric G4, inhibits the activities of DHX36 and BLM helicases. Telomeric G4s ligand 2 activates cGAS-STING and TERRA-ZBP1 pathways, inducing autophagy and G2/M cell cycle arrest, and exhibits antiproliferative effects across cancer cell lines. Telomeric G4s ligand 2 can be used for the study of colorectal cancer .

G6374 is a IRE1 PRORAC degrader with DC50 values of 0.04 μM (AMO1) and 0.13 μM (KMS27), an EC50 value of 0.11 μM, and KD values of 0.56 nM and 90.2 nM for IRE1 and VHL, respectively. G6374 binds to the ATP pocket of the IRE1 kinase domain and VHL to form a ternary complex that recruits CRL2 VHL, inducing K48-linked polyubiquitination of IRE1 at lysine residues K704 and K717, which in turn drives proteasomal degradation of monomeric and dimeric IRE1. G6374 can be used for the research of multiple myeloma .

(K(C10)GGGRrRPC)2 (Compound (C-C10)C-C) is a dimeric lipopeptide and antibacterial agent. (K(C10)GGGRrRPC)2 enhances the accumulation of ROS, inhibits the bacterial respiratory chain dehydrogenase activity. (K(C10)GGGRrRPC)2 exhibits significant inhibition of bacterial biofilm formation. (K(C10)GGGRrRPC)2 exhibits antimicrobial activity against Acinetobacter baumannii AB1901, A. baumannii AB1902, Pseudomonas aeruginosa 25349, Staphylococcus aureus 11011, with MICs of 4 μM, 8 μM, 4 μM, and 8 μM, respectively. (K(C10)GGGRrRPC)2 shows antimicrobial efficacy against E. coli ATCC 25922 .

Cyclomarin A is an antibacterial agent with a Kd of 2.3 nM against Mycobacterium tuberculosis ClpC1, a Kd of 2.2 nM against ClpC2, and an IC50 of 0.004 μM against Plasmodium falciparum PfAp3Aase. Cyclomarin A binds to the N-terminal domain of ClpC1, stimulates ATPase and proteolytic activities, dysregulates proteolysis, and induces proteome imbalance; it also binds to ClpC2 and upregulates its transcription level. Cyclomarin A binds to PfAp3Aase in dimeric form, blocks the substrate-binding pathway, inhibits the growth of Plasmodium falciparum in the erythrocytic stage, and shows no activity against human cells. Cyclomarin A exhibits moderate cytotoxicity against a variety of cancer cell lines. Cyclomarin A can serve as a lead compound for the development of Homo-BacPROTAC. Cyclomarin A is applicable to research related to tuberculosis and malaria .
